Attic spaces are one of the most common areas where buildings lose heat during colder months. When attic insulation becomes thin, uneven, or settled over time, warm air can escape more easily through the ceiling and roof structure, making indoor temperatures harder to maintain consistently.
Poor attic insulation can leave upper floors feeling colder, increase strain on heating systems, and reduce overall energy efficiency throughout the property.

Proper attic insulation helps slow heat movement through the ceiling and attic structure while improving comfort between upper and lower floors during both winter and summer conditions.
For many older homes, commercial buildings, and agricultural structures, upgrading attic insulation is one of the most effective ways to improve energy efficiency and long-term indoor comfort without major renovation work.
